Requirements and Costs of Registered Agents

When selecting a registered agent, it is important to comprehend the requirements that differ by state. Typically, a registered agent must be a inhabitant of the region where your company is established or an organization licensed to do commerce in that region. Additionally, the registered agent must have a real address, as P.O. Boxes are not allowed. This address serves as the designated point of contact for receiving legal notices and state notices. Comprehending these state-specific requirements is crucial to making sure your business remains in compliance.

Ways to Modify Your Registered Agent

Changing your agent of record is a simple process that can be accomplished by adhering to a small number of key instructions. To start, examine your current agent contract to identify any specific protocols or conditions for ending the agreement. The majority of agreements will detail how and when you can officially replace your registered agent, ensuring you comply with any necessary notification timeframes.

Afterward, you will need to identify a different registered agent, whether that be a reliable local registered agent or a nationwide registered agent service that fits your requirements. Take into account factors such as cost, reliability, and extra offerings provided, like compliance reminders and mail management, to make certain you have the most suitable registered agent provider for your business. Once you have selected a new registered agent, you will generally need to fill out a change of agent form, which can commonly be found on your state's SOS portal.

At last, submit the form along with any necessary charges to the appropriate state agency. After your request is reviewed, make sure you receive confirmation of the agent change. It's also important to notify your former agent to officially terminate the relationship and to update your business records properly. Common Questions about Registered Agents

Many business owners frequently have questions about what a registered agent can be and what their responsibilities involve. A registered agent, often referred to as a statutory agent or agent for service of process, is an individual or business entity appointed to receive legal documents on behalf of a company. This includes significant documents such as lawsuits, subpoenas, and communications from the state. Most states require businesses, whether they are LLCs or corporations, to have a registered agent to guarantee there is a reliable point of contact, especially for delivery of legal documents.
